The recent headlines, detailing the alleged kidnapping of a Chinese national by Thai police, have cast a shadow over the usually positive image of Thailand as a tourist haven. The accusations paint a troubling picture, suggesting a breach of trust between the local authorities and the public, specifically foreign nationals. The reported incident, involving the alleged abduction of a Chinese man, Qi, and his subsequent release after a substantial ransom payment, involves several officers from the immigration department. According to reports, a Thai woman, acting as Qi's translator, played a key role in the alleged extortion scheme, claiming that she and her employer were held captive by these officers. Following her report to authorities, three of the officers were arrested, while one remains at large. The alleged involvement of a police officer at the rank of major and two lieutenants, along with a senior police officer, raises serious questions about the efficacy of Thai law enforcement.

This incident, while isolated, prompts a crucial discussion about the safety concerns faced by tourists in Thailand, especially those from countries with varying cultural backgrounds or who are unfamiliar with local customs and legal procedures. The alleged extortion and kidnapping are serious violations of human rights and the law, highlighting the potential for exploitation of vulnerable individuals. The reported refusal of the arrested officers to admit guilt, despite seemingly substantial evidence, further complicates the matter. This suggests a potential systemic issue within certain segments of the Thai police force, requiring comprehensive investigation and action.
